I have a field called 'Day' that has data for Days of the Week.
I put the Day field in the 'Column' section of the layout for the Pivot Table.

The order is alphabetical meaning Friday comes first, followed by Monday and then Saturday and so on.


How in a Pivot Table can I correct the order manually, so the days of the week would be in the proper order?
That is,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day, Friday, Saturday, Sunday.

Hi. To do it manually you can go to the cell (Friday for example) and type the day (Monday for example) over it. This will change the order. Type the day you want to be on the first column, second column, and so on.
